## What is the Algorithm of Path Dependency Quantification?

Path Dependency Quantification, within cryptocurrency and derivatives, represents a computational approach to model the influence of historical price sequences on current valuations. This methodology extends beyond simple time series analysis, acknowledging that present market states are not solely determined by immediate conditions but are intrinsically linked to preceding events. Accurate quantification necessitates robust stochastic modeling, often employing Monte Carlo simulations to trace potential price paths and their associated derivative values, particularly crucial for exotic options. The resulting framework allows for a more nuanced risk assessment, moving beyond delta-neutral hedging to account for path-dependent payoffs.

## What is the Calibration of Path Dependency Quantification?

Implementing Path Dependency Quantification requires meticulous calibration of underlying models to observed market data, a process complicated by the non-linear nature of derivative pricing. Volatility surfaces, incorporating skew and kurtosis, are essential inputs, alongside accurate correlation structures between underlying assets, especially in cryptocurrency where market linkages are still evolving. Backtesting against historical data is paramount, but forward-looking calibration, utilizing implied volatility from actively traded options, provides a more relevant assessment of model performance. This iterative refinement process is vital for maintaining the predictive power of the quantification.

## What is the Consequence of Path Dependency Quantification?

The practical consequence of precise Path Dependency Quantification lies in improved pricing accuracy and refined risk management strategies for complex financial instruments. In cryptocurrency options, where liquidity can be fragmented and price discovery imperfect, this is particularly valuable, enabling more informed trading decisions and portfolio construction. Furthermore, a thorough understanding of path dependency allows for the development of tailored hedging strategies that mitigate exposure to specific market scenarios, reducing potential losses during periods of high volatility or unexpected price movements.
